As Plant/Operations Manager, you’ll lead and optimize day-to-day operations at our manufacturing facility. You’ll ensure high-quality LED lighting products are delivered efficiently, safely, and cost-effectively, aligning operational goals with Vice Lighting’s premium standards and custom manufacturing capabilities.
Key Responsibilities
• Operations & Production Management
Manage production planning and scheduling to meet output targets, customer deadlines, and budgetary goals based on capacity and demand
Coordinate across manufacturing, quality control, and maintenance teams.
Follow-up the material, drawings, ressources to meet the deadlines
Provide technical support and directives to the production team
Follow-up with subcontractors’ technical issues and delivery dates
Motivate, coach and train production team
Communicate the management decisions and strategies to the production team
• Quality, Compliance & Safety
Ensure consistent product quality, adherence to specification standards, and compliance with relevant regulatory frameworks (e.g. health and safety, electrical standards)
Lead safety training, incident reporting, and corrective actions.
Ensure the ISO procedures are followed
• Continuous Improvement & Lean Practices
Identify process inefficiencies and implement lean methodologies (e.g. waste reduction, cycle-time reduction, Kanban, 5S) to elevate plant performance, throughput, and yield Monitor and report on KPIs: downtime, scrap rates, OEE, productivity metrics.
• Equipment & Maintenance Oversight
Maintain machinery reliability via preventative maintenance programs.
Plan equipment upgrades and capital investments in collaboration with engineering.
• Budget & Cost Control
Manage and optimize operational and production budgets, including overhead, labor, material, and maintenance costs.
Measure actual performance vs. budget goals and investigate variance
Keep the stock accurate and direct inventories
• Team Leadership & Development
Supervise plant supervisors, technicians, and floor staff.
Drive a high-performance, safety-first culture, mentor future leaders, promote accountability, and oversee hiring and performance reviews.
• Cross-functional Collaboration
Liaise with R&D, design, sales, logistics, and headquarters to ensure smooth project execution, especially for custom lighting solutions.
